BIRDSONG, Judge.
This is a laborer's suit to recover for services performed. The plaintiff below, Hager, contracted to build an addition to O'Neal's home. A dispute arose as to the quality and sufficiency of the work completed by Hager. O'Neal paid all but $1,400 of the contract price but refused to pay for the remainder.
